ob+picgo+image auto uploaded插件配置好图床以后,往ob粘贴图片,图片不显示出来

各位大佬好,我用ob+picgo+image auto uploaded自动上传插件配置好图床以后,

但是在ob粘贴图片的时候,图片只显示出来一个链接,图片内容无法展示,这是什么原因呢

我排除了一下,picgo是可以上传成功的,每次粘贴图片以后也会弹出提示说上传成功,但是ob里面就是显示不出来这张图,想问问大家有遇到类似情况吗。


遇到的问题

仔细叙述你的问题。最好附上自己使用的 Obsidian 版本及环境。

预期的效果

你认为没有问题时应该是怎样的。这里最好描述你的本质需求,而非解决方案。比如渴了是需求,但研究出一杯饮料来解渴并不是需求。

已尝试的解决方案

尝试了怎样的解决方法,为什么行不通等等。

“picgo是可以上传成功的” 另开隐私模式浏览器窗口, 这图片链接是可以看见的吗?

你好,感谢回复,不过我没太明白您意思,我在ob粘贴图片以后,是有图片链接的,腾讯云服务器里面也有图片,就是ob展示的时候,显示不出来图片

首先试试其他地址的外链图, 能否在 Ob 里显示,

比如这论坛的图是可以外链的

![demo-img](https://forum-zh.obsidian.md/uploads/default/original/2X/c/cbad7220ce1cc5a272384411cc00d4a14f8e763d.png)

以上贴 Ob 里应该能直接显示

这为了看看 Ob 是所有外链图都裂了, 还是只有你腾讯云的图裂了

如果这时没问题, 那再看看 腾讯云的图, 另开隐私浏览器窗口能否显示, 这为了确定该图的访问权限

整个过程, 最好禁掉不相关插件防干扰


你好,谢谢回复,我在浏览器,打开隐私浏览器窗口显示,是能看到,但往ob里面粘贴图片的时候,还是不显示

那么 Ob 中, 一部分外链图是能正常显示的

如果确定 隐私浏览器窗口, 无登录状态, 可以正常看到腾讯云提供的外链图, 那可能得看看后缀之类的问题, 或者你贴一个你的腾讯云图到这里, 能显示吗?

收到!谢谢回复,以下是我直接从腾讯云copy过来的链接,我检察一下文件后缀,或者是不是插件冲突问题,

权限问题吧, 你看你的图,

不带token时就裂了, 带一堆鉴权参数则可以访问 (见下面两张, 贴到 Ob 里)

![demo1](https://01-ob-imageinbox-1316020729.cos.ap-nanjing.myqcloud.com/0101-image/202304111150095.png)

![demo2](https://01-ob-imageinbox-1316020729.cos.ap-nanjing.myqcloud.com/0101-image/202304111150095.png?q-sign-algorithm=sha1&q-ak=AKID3...后面删除)

是不是跟腾讯云设置有关? 设好了公开访问权限了吗?

丢一个你桶存储的图片链接出来试试看用网页打得开吗

我没用过它这服务啊,

试了你这图片, 如果不加后面参数, 在浏览器里就 access denied,
加了后面参数, 在浏览器里就ok

就是权限设置的事吧?

谢谢!我刚刚更改了一下腾讯云上面的权限设置,设置为公有读写就显示出图片了来,感谢您!

谢谢回复,楼上这位大佬帮我解决了,是我腾讯云权限设置的问题,感谢回复

to allworldg
我刚才好像看错人了, 不好意思~

to 走路有风
别客气, 如果是隐私资料, 记得重生成 token, 一般厂商也会帮你在意安全, 但还是自己小心点好

请问我也出现了这样问题,但是桌面端正常,手机端就不行,比如下面这个
image.png

http://www.guoqs.cn:10086/i/2024/03/07/65e8978acbd94.png
这个图片地址是可以在没有 token 的情况下访问的

跨域访问设置的事?

手机端怎么不行的, 得具体点, 例:

  • 手机自带浏览器, 单独贴图片 url 到地址栏, 显示吗?
  • 手机自带浏览器, 访问网页, 网页里外链这个图, 显示吗?
  • Ob 里阅读和编辑视图都不显示吗, 有插件影响吗

刚在群里面有人找到一篇关于IOS新版本把图床的HTTP的访问给封禁了。只能访问https的。我修改访问路径后就正常显示了。感谢。

以上文章有提及。

1 个赞

这样的话,用坚果云做图床是不是就不行了,因为那个毕竟是私密的,没有公开读写。我这两天用坚果云做图床,传上去就在obsidian里看不到图了,一篇灰色。